Ask for help:** send your question to `ask@hii.hii.so` — AI support agent powered by Claude Sonnet. ## What this product is HII Mail is an email-native control plane for AI agents. You create an agent. The platform gives it an email address. Anyone who knows that address can send it work. The agent can reply, keep context in its mailbox, and proactively communicate back out. ## Product pillars 1. **Permanent address** — every agent gets a stable address like `assistant@yourname.hii.so`. 2. **Durable mailbox** — messages survive sessions, restarts, and model swaps. 3. **Active outbound channel** — agents can reply to people and systems through email. 4. **Unlisted by default** — reachability comes from sharing the address, not from browsing a marketplace. ## API base URL All API calls use `https://hii.so/api/v1/...`. Talk to the custom agent curl -s https://hii.so/api/v1/mail/send -H "Authorization: Bearer YOUR_API_KEY" -d '{"to":"tarot@yourname.hii.so","body":"Draw me a card","sync":true}' ``` ## System agents (auto-created on signup) Every account gets 3 system agents for free. They don't count toward your agent limit. | Address | Role | How it works | |---------|------|-------------| | `inbox@yourname.hii.so` | AI brain | Default AI assistant. Send any message, get an AI reply. Customize with system_prompt. | | `hello@yourname.hii.so` | Profile | Returns the owner's self-introduction. Edit with PUT /api/v1/agents/hello. | | `do@yourname.hii.so` | Task executor | Send instructions (natural language or JSON), get results. | | `auth@yourname.hii.so` | Auth gateway | Sign in with HII — passwordless login for external services | Customize system agents: `PUT /api/v1/agents/inbox` with system_prompt, llm_provider, etc. These names are reserved — you cannot create custom agents with names "inbox", "hello", "do", or "auth". ## Sign in with HII Any external service can use HII Mail for passwordless authentication: ``` # 1. Get user profile (24h token) curl https://hii.so/api/v1/auth/userinfo \ -H "Authorization: Bearer hii_at_..." # → {"ok": true, "username": "...", "hii_email": "...", "display_name": "..."} ``` Scopes: `profile` (default), `email` (includes verified status), `plan` (includes tier). ## Simplified agent model When you create an agent, use these fields first: - `name` — mailbox local-part - `description` — short job description - `mode` — `ai`, `mailbox`, `webhook`, or `worker` - `visibility` — `unlisted`, `listed`, or `private` - `system_prompt` — only needed for AI auto-replies - `reply_mode` — `auto`, `smart`, `review`, or `manual` ### Decision Review Queue Agents can draft replies for human review instead of sending immediately. | reply_mode | Behavior | |------------|----------| | `auto` | Send immediately (default) | | `smart` | **Recommended.** Auto-decide: low/medium risk → send, high/critical → review | | `review` | Always draft for review | | `manual` | Draft only, never auto-send | Smart mode classifies risk automatically: - **low/medium**: routine content, internal recipients → auto-send - **high**: pricing, deadlines, urgent content → draft for review - **critical**: payment, legal, credentials, secrets → draft for review Owner gets an actionable email with one-click Approve/Reject links. Review Queue API: - `GET /agents/{name}/drafts` — list draft replies for an agent - `PUT /drafts/{id}` — edit draft body/subject before sending - `POST /drafts/{id}/send` — approve and send the draft - `DELETE /drafts/{id}` — discard the draft MCP tools: `list_review_queue`, `review_approve`, `review_discard` ### Custom LLM (optional) Agents use a free built-in LLM by default. You can connect your own LLM for better quality: - `llm_provider` — `openai`, `anthropic`, `google`, or empty (system default) - `llm_model` — model ID (e.g., `gpt-4o`, `claude-sonnet-4-5`, `gemini-2.5-flash`) - `llm_api_key` — your API key for the chosen provider Supported models: - **OpenAI**: gpt-4o, gpt-4o-mini, gpt-4.1 - **Anthropic**: claude-sonnet-4-5, claude-haiku-4-5 - **Google**: gemini-2.5-pro, gemini-2.5-flash, gemini-2.0-flash Set these when creating or updating an agent via `POST /api/v1/agents` or `PUT /api/v1/agents/{name}`. If your custom LLM fails, the system falls back to the built-in LLM automatically. ## Structured I/O Two ways to get JSON responses: 1. **Per-message**: Add `"response_format":"json"` to any send request — no schema needed. 2. **Per-agent**: Set `output_schema` (JSON Schema string) on your agent for schema-validated JSON. When JSON is detected in the reply, a `structured` field is added to the sync response with the parsed object. If `output_schema` is set, the response also includes `schema_valid` (bool) and `schema_error` (string, if invalid). Works with all LLM providers — OpenAI uses native `response_format: json_object`, Gemini uses `responseMimeType`. ## Public agent pages Every agent has a public profile page at `https://hii.so/a/{namespace}/{agent_name}`. Visitors can try the agent directly from the page — no account or API key needed. API: `POST /api/v1/public/try/{namespace}/{agent_name}` with `{"message":"your text"}`. Rate limited to 5 requests per IP per agent per hour. Max 500 chars. ## MCP Server (for Claude, Cursor, etc.) HII Mail has an MCP server with 27 tools for deep integration. Attachments: `"attachments": [{"filename": "doc.pdf", "content": "", "content_type": "application/pdf"}]` (multiple allowed). ## Reply / Reply All `POST /api/v1/mail/messages/{message_id}/reply` — Gmail-style reply. Auto-sets to, cc, subject (Re:), threading. | Field | Type | Description | |-------|------|-------------| | `body` | string | Reply message (required) | | `reply_all` | bool | `true` = sender + all CC recipients (default: false = sender only) | | `subject` | string | Override subject (default: auto Re: prefix) | | `sync` | bool | Wait for agent reply inline | | `attachments` | array | File attachments (same format as mail/send) | ```bash # Reply (sender only) curl -X POST https://hii.so/api/v1/mail/messages/MSG_ID/reply \ -H "Authorization: Bearer YOUR_API_KEY" \ -d '{"body": "Thanks!"}' # Reply All (sender + CC) curl -X POST https://hii.so/api/v1/mail/messages/MSG_ID/reply \ -H "Authorization: Bearer YOUR_API_KEY" \ -d '{"body": "Thanks everyone!", "reply_all": true}' ``` Reply logic (Gmail-compatible): - Reply-To header takes priority over From - Replying to own sent mail → sends to original recipient - Reply All excludes yourself from CC - Subject auto-prefixed with `Re:` (deduped: `Re: Re: Hi` → `Re: Hi`) MCP tool: `reply` (message_id + body + reply_all). ## Core endpoints **Account & agents:** - `POST /api/v1/signup` — create account and get API key (+ 3 system agents) - `POST /api/v1/agents` — create agent mailbox - `PUT /api/v1/agents/{name}` — update agent (LLM, cron, tags, etc.) - `DELETE /api/v1/agents/{name}` — delete agent - `GET /api/v1/agents` — list your agents - `GET /api/v1/resolve?address=agent@ns.hii.so` — resolve an address **Mail:** - `POST /api/v1/mail/send` — send mail or invoke agent (add `sync:true` for instant reply) - `POST /api/v1/mail/messages/{id}/reply` — reply or reply-all (auto to/cc/subject/threading) - `POST /api/v1/mail/batch` — send up to 20 messages at once - `GET /api/v1/mail/inbox` — read your mailbox - `GET /api/v1/mail/search?q=keyword` — search messages - `GET /api/v1/mail/threads/{hii_id}` — get conversation thread **Worker runtime (heartbeat):** - `POST /api/v1/agents/{name}/poll` — poll for tasks (worker agents) - `POST /api/v1/tasks/{task_id}/heartbeat` — extend task lease - `POST /api/v1/tasks/{task_id}/complete` — mark task done with result - `POST /api/v1/tasks/{task_id}/fail` — mark task failed (auto-retry if retryable) **Monitoring & management:** - `GET /api/v1/usage?period=today` — usage stats (sends, received, per-agent, daily limit) - `GET /api/v1/agents/{name}/logs?limit=20` — agent message history - `GET /api/v1/keys` — list your API keys - `DELETE /api/v1/keys/{key_id}` — revoke an API key - `GET /api/v1/events` — poll events (mail.received, task.completed, etc.) - `GET /api/v1/events/stream` — real-time SSE event stream **Webhooks:** - `POST /api/v1/webhooks` — register a webhook (events: mail.received, task.completed, etc.) - `GET /api/v1/webhooks` — list your webhooks - `DELETE /api/v1/webhooks/{id}` — delete a webhook - `POST /api/v1/webhooks/{id}/test` — send a test event to verify integration (returns status_code, response_time) Webhook signatures use HMAC-SHA256: `X-HII-Signature: sha256={hex}`, signed over `{timestamp}.{payload}`. Verify: reject if `abs(time.time() - X-HII-Timestamp) > 300`. **Billing:** - `POST /api/v1/billing/checkout` — upgrade to Pro/Ultra (Stripe) ## Recipes — common patterns for AI agents ### Daily report (cron + send) Your agent collects data and emails a summary every morning. ```python # crontab: 0 9 * * * python3 /path/to/daily_report.py import requests, json data = collect_your_data() # your logic report = summarize(data) requests.post("https://hii.so/api/v1/mail/send", headers={ "Authorization": "Bearer YOUR_API_KEY", "Content-Type": "application/json", }, json={ "to": "juno@hii.so", "subject": f"Daily Report — {today}", "body": report, "cc": "team@gmail.com", }) ``` ### Heartbeat (dead man's switch) Agent pings every 30 min.
